Top 10 Hardest Riddles in the World with Answers​

Before we dive into the riddles, get ready to challenge your mind with the top 10 hardest riddles in the world:

1. What walks on four legs in the morning, two legs at noon, and three legs in the evening?
Answer:
A human (A baby crawls on all fours, an adult walks on two legs, and an elderly person uses a cane.)

2. The day before two days after the day before tomorrow is Saturday. What day is today?
Answer:
Friday

3. A father and his son are in a car accident. The father dies instantly, and the son is rushed to the hospital. The doctor looks at the boy and says, “I cannot operate on this boy. He is my son.” How is this possible?
Answer: The doctor is the boy’s mother.

4. The more you take, the more you leave behind. What am I?
Answer:
Footsteps

5. You are trapped in a room with two doors. One door leads to certain death, the other to freedom. Two guards stand in front of the doors—one always tells the truth, and the other always lies. You can ask only one question. What do you ask?
Answer:
“If I were to ask the other guard which door leads to freedom, what would they say?” Then, take the opposite door.

6. The more you say my name, the less you have of me. What am I?
Answer: Silence

7. You are in a dark room with a table covered in 100 coins. Exactly 10 coins are heads-up, and the rest are tails. You cannot see which ones are which. You must separate the coins into two piles with the same number of heads-up coins. How do you do it?
Answer:
Flip any 10 coins. (No matter which ones you flip, the number of heads will be equal in both piles.)

8. The more you remove from me, the larger I grow. What am I?
Answer:
A hole.

9. Two people are born at the same time, on the same day, in the same year, and have the same parents, but they are not twins. How is this possible?
Answer:
They are triplets (or quadruplets, etc.).

10. A man hangs himself in a room with no furniture and a ceiling too high to reach. The only thing in the room is a puddle of water. How did he do it?
Answer:
He stood on a block of ice, which melted over time.

Hardest Detective Riddles​

Let’s explore the hardest riddles in a detective twist:

1. A woman was having dinner at a restaurant. She ordered a coffee. She drank half of it and went to the restroom. When she returned, she finished the coffee and immediately died. The police found out it was poisoned. But why did she survive the first half of the coffee?
Answer:
The poison was in the ice cubes. They hadn’t melted when she drank the first half, but after time, they dissolved into the coffee, poisoning it.

2. A man was found murdered on a snowy Sunday morning. His wife said she was sleeping, the chef claimed he was cooking breakfast, the gardener was picking vegetables, and the maid said she was getting the mail. Who did it?
Answer: The maid—there is no mail on Sundays!

3. A dead man is found inside a completely empty locked room. The only objects in the room are a puddle of water and a rope hanging from the ceiling. How did he die?
Answer:
He stood on a block of ice to hang himself, and it melted over time.

4. A rich woman called the police, claiming her diamond ring had been stolen. When the detective arrived, he noticed the window was broken from the inside, and there were glass shards outside the house. Who stole the ring?
Answer: The woman herself—if a burglar had broken in, the glass would be inside, not outside.
